    The solution set of the equation\[{{\tan }^{-1}}x-{{\cot }^{-1}}x={{\cos }^{-1}}(2-x)\] will lie in the interval

    A) \[[0,1]\]

    B) \[[-1,1]\]

    C) \[[1,3]\] 

    D) None of these

    Correct Answer: C

    Solution :

    [c] \[{{\tan }^{-1}}x\] and \[{{\cot }^{-1}}x\] exist for all \[x\in R\]\[{{\cos }^{-1}}(2-x)\]exists if \[-1\le 2-x\le 1\]i.e. \[1\le x\le 3\] So, the given equation holds for \[1\le x\le 3\]
